Overview

GPUX is a serverless GPU inference platform for running AI models in the cloud without managing infrastructure: it supports models including StableDiffusionXL, ESRGAN, and Whisper alongside custom LLMs, with a 1-second cold start for rapid model initialization and ReadWrite Volumes for persistent data across inference runs.

The 1-second cold start is the detail that actually matters for a serverless GPU product – traditional serverless inference often carries a multi-second-to-minutes cold-start penalty when a GPU instance has to spin up from idle, which makes serverless pricing attractive on paper but impractical for latency-sensitive use cases. GPUX also lets organizations with a private trained model sell inference requests against it to other organizations, turning a proprietary model into a monetizable API rather than an internal-only asset.

GPUX reports making StableDiffusionXL 50% faster on RTX 4090 hardware, with cost reductions of 50-90% over always-on GPU infrastructure. Pricing starts as low as $0.2/hour, targeting developers and organizations running AI inference workloads without dedicated infrastructure teams.

Pros & cons

Pros

  • 1-second cold start solves the main practical drawback of serverless GPU inference
  • Low entry pricing ($0.2/hour) with significant reported cost savings
  • Private model monetization option turns internal tools into revenue

Cons

  • Requires technical setup – built for developers, not a no-code end-user tool
  • Cost savings depend heavily on actual usage patterns versus always-on alternatives
  • Model support, while broad, doesn't cover every possible AI architecture
